Purpose and goal

Juteborg AB is the initiator and project owner of Jute-Top2, a project aimed at showing JuteTech as reinforcement in composites instead of fiberglass in order to achieve more sustainable solutions. Together with Clean Motion, Ljungby Composite and Rise, we have developed a prototype of a Zbee, where we replaced the roof / back component with JuteTech instead of glass fiber. The prototype vehicle has been named JuteBee and is available to view / test drive in connection with Juteborg AB´s office on the rooftop of Nordstan´s parking house, Gothenburg. Expected results and effects

The prototype was tested on the basis of normal procedure after production and partly after about 4 months of use in normal traffic. Both the brake test and the escape maneuver test were carried out with high torque stresses. During the tests, no differences were experienced compared to the series-produced Zbee. After each test, cracks, deformations, etc. were carefully examined and no changes were noted. With the JuteBee-project we have received an answer that it is easier (marginally), cheaper, more environmentally friendly and more beautiful to use JuteTech in the roof section.

Planned approach and implementation

Juteborg AB was the initiator and the project owner. Clean Motion believed in Juteborg´s idea and was willing to make available their tools and expertise in the production plant at Ljungby Composite. Juteborg adapted JuteTech together with partners in Bangladesh and several material samples were produced and analyzed by Rise in Piteå, before the full-scale prototype could was produced. Ljungby Composite was very helpful in selecting the most suitable JuteTech for the purpose, i e the roof / rear part of the Zbee. The choice of a transparent gel coat made the analysis work easier.
